Canvas 坐标系统是绘图基础,其中点 (0,0) 位于 Canvas 组件左上角,X 轴水平向右延伸,Y 轴垂直向下延伸。create_arc:绘制弧。create_bitmap:绘制位图。create_image:绘制图片。create_line():绘制直线。create_polygon:绘制多边形。create_text:绘制文字。create_window:绘制组件。create
 检测这些圆,先找轮廓后通过轮廓点拟合椭圆import cv2 import numpy as np import matplotlib.pyplot as plt import math from Ransac_Process import RANSAC def lj_img(img): wlj, hlj = img.shape[1], img.shape[0]
转载 2023-09-18 00:10:02
486阅读
# Python椭圆绘制 椭圆,在几何学中是被称为一种平面曲线,可以定义为平面上到两个定点距离之和是常数集合。椭圆可以用来表示许多自然现象,比如行星轨道,或者在数据可视化中,椭圆也常用于展示数据分布情况。 在 Python 中,我们可以利用一些图形库来绘制椭圆。本篇文章将介绍如何使用 `matplotlib` 库绘制椭圆,并将代码以示例形式呈现出来。 ## 安装 matp
原创 2024-10-05 06:09:53
43阅读
误差椭圆是统计学中用于表示多维数据分布重要概念,尤其在进行分类、回归分析及多元统计时帮助理解变量之间关系。在Python中,通过可视化误差椭圆,可以更直观地展示不同变量之间相关性。在本文中,我们将详细复盘如何通过Python代码实现这一过程。 ### 背景描述 在数据分析中,我们常常需要将多维数据进行可视化,以便于观察其分布和相关性。误差椭圆是有效可视化工具,尤其适合用于四象限图场景
原创 6月前
60阅读
# Python 绘制椭圆简单代码与应用 椭圆是一个非常重要几何图形,它在数学、物理和工程学中都有着广泛应用。在计算机图形学中,使用编程语言绘制椭圆是一项基本技能。本文将介绍如何使用 Python 以及相关库来绘制椭圆,并通过示例代码加深理解。 ## 1. Python 绘图库概述 在 Python 中,我们可以使用多个库来进行绘图。其中最常用包括: - **Matplotlib**
原创 10月前
208阅读
好久没有写过原生JS了,突然没事做,写了一个跟着鼠标走加载小动画,最终效果如下图:这个效果实现起来非常简单,大概思路是:先用 CSS3 border-radius 属性将三个 div 样式设置为圆形,然后定义一个椭圆路径,最后用定时器或帧函数使得三个 div 绕着椭圆路径旋转,同时椭圆路径中点始终跟随者鼠标移动。有了思路就可以开始写代码了,先把 html 和 css 部分写好:<!
# 椭圆曲线加密基本概念与Python实现 在现代密码学中,椭圆曲线加密(Elliptic Curve Cryptography, ECC)是一种非常重要加密技术。它以更少计算资源提供与传统公钥加密方法相同级别的安全性。本文将介绍椭圆曲线基本概念,如何使用Python实现椭圆曲线加密,并提供代码示例。 ## 什么是椭圆曲线? 椭圆曲线是一种特别的代数曲线,通常以如下形式定义: \[
原创 9月前
282阅读
在数学中,椭圆是围绕两个焦点平面中曲线,使得对于曲线上每个点,到两个焦点距离之和是恒定。因此,它是圆概括,其是具有两个焦点在相同位置处特殊类型椭圆椭圆形状(如何“伸长”)由其偏心度表示,对于椭圆可以是从0(圆极限情况)到任意接近但小于1任何数字。椭圆是封闭式圆锥截面:由锥体与平面相交平面曲线(见右图)。椭圆与其他两种形式圆锥截面有很多相似之处:抛物面和双曲线,两者都是开
© 2018 *All rights reserved by liudx .:smile: Pythonmatplotlib是一个功能强大绘图库,可以很方便绘制数学图形。官方给出了很多简单实例,结合中文翻译示例Tutorial,可以满足日常工作大部分需求了。但是实际工作中,一些有趣东西很难使用常规方程(笛卡尔坐标和极坐标)方式绘制,事实上,大部分工程上都是使用参数方程来描述曲线。本文
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ta
转载 2023-06-23 18:11:43
110阅读
# Python画给定椭圆方程曲线代码 ## 引言 在数学中,椭圆是一个有趣几何形状。它可以通过方程来描述,而Python是一种功能强大且易于学习编程语言。本文将介绍如何使用Python来绘制给定椭圆方程曲线,通过代码示例和详细说明,让您可以轻松理解和实践。 ## 椭圆方程 椭圆方程可以表示为: ``` (x - h)^2 / a^2 + (y - k)^2 / b^2 =
原创 2024-01-20 10:02:13
337阅读
import java.awt.*; import javax.swing.*; /** * 画椭圆 */ public class AppGraphInOut extends JFrame{ //定义界面 public static void main(String[] args){ JFrame circle = new AppGraphInOut();
转载 2023-05-31 20:35:26
295阅读
Python画熊猫代码——Python椭圆
原创 2023-04-26 17:44:38
1402阅读
中点椭圆算法:(对于原点为(xc,yc)椭圆,假定圆心在坐标原点(0,0)像素位置,把计算出每个椭圆上像素点(x,y)加到屏幕位置上,即(xc+x,yc+y) ) 椭圆与圆不同,不能八分只能四分。中点椭圆算法将分成两部分应用于第一象限。在斜率绝对值小于1区域内在x方向取单位步长,在斜率绝对值大于1区域内在y方向取单位步长。    
1>滤波器分析和实现 abs求绝对值(幅值) angle求相角conv求卷积fftfilt利用重叠相加法基于FFTFIR滤波filter利用IIR或FIR滤波器对数据进行滤波filtfilt零相位数字滤波filtic为移位直接II型滤波器选择初始条件freqs模拟滤波器频率相应freqspace 控制频率相应中频率间隔freqz数字滤波器频率相应grpdelay 平均滤波延迟(群
# 如何实现Python海龟绘图画椭圆 ## 概述 作为一名经验丰富开发者,我将向你介绍如何使用Python海龟绘图库来画椭圆。这对于刚入行小白来说可能有些困难,但是通过本文指导你将能够轻松掌握这个技能。 ## 流程 下面是画椭圆整个流程,我将用表格形式展示出来: | 步骤 | 操作 | | ---- | ---- | | 1 | 导入海龟绘图库 | | 2 | 创建画布 | |
原创 2024-04-21 06:59:55
516阅读
1评论
# 使用Python绘制三维椭球体 在这篇文章中,我们将探讨如何使用Python绘制三维椭球体,并理解这些代码背后原理。我们会生成一个三维椭球可视化效果,同时介绍其中数学基础。 ## 椭球体数学基础 椭球体是一种三维几何形状,可以通过定义其三个半轴长(x、y、z)来描述。椭球标准方程为: \[ \frac{x^2}{a^2} + \frac{y^2}{b^2} + \frac{z
原创 11月前
151阅读
椭圆曲线加密算法(ECC - Elliptic curve encryption algorithm)是基于椭圆曲线数学一种公钥加密算法。随着计算机计算能力不断提升,RSA使用率越来越高。但是为了安全,其密钥长度一直饱受诟病,于是ECC这种新算法使用率和重要性都在逐年上升。现在就来介绍一下椭圆曲线加密算法。一. 椭圆曲线方程椭圆曲线是这样一个齐次方程 y2+a1xy+a3y=x3
按win+q键换出搜索界面,输入path,进入系统属性,选择高级,选择环境变量。在系统变量中PATHEXT这个变量中文本内容为.COM;.EXE;.BAT;.CMD;.VBS;.VBE;.JS;.JSE;.WSF;.WSH;.MSC。如果这个文本内容中没有.EXE,在cmd中输入命令时候则不能省略.exe后缀,
椭圆拟合实验目的和要求尝试使用 cv.fitEllipse()函数,对图像进行椭圆拟合实验内容和原理椭圆拟合该函数使用是最小二乘法拟合,要求输入点至少有 6 个。函数中对应参数如下:对输入图像预处理输入一张 RGB 图片,先转换为灰度图,本来打算先转换为二值图像再进行边缘检测,但是发现二值化容易使阴影成为新边缘,并丢失原有边缘信息,于是直接对灰度图进行了边缘检测。在边缘检测前还进行了降
  • 1
  • 2
  • 3
  • 4
  • 5